In 1887 Joseph
O'Connell, of Chicago, conceived of the use of tiny electric lights as signals, a brilliant idea, as an electric light makes no noise and can be seen either by night or by day.

figure By BERNARD ROTICH figure By DENNIS LUBANGA Renowned athletics coach Brother Colm
O'Connell was on Saturday honoured for his contribution to the country's track and field events in the last four decades.O'Connell, who arrived in the country in July 1976, was feted by the County Government of Elgeyo Marakwet which named one of the streets in Iten Town after him as he marked his 70th birthday.
A film has been premiered about the extraordinary times of an Irish rebel called Patrick
O'Connell who was player-manager ofAshingtonin the early 1920s before walking out on his wife and four children to begin a secret life in Spain.
